The United States was founded upon certain important principles — one of which guarantees its citizens the right to free speech.

In the past couple of decades or so — particularly since 9/11 — Americans have witnessed this right being increasingly eroded. Authorities have begun identifying ordinary citizens as “potential terrorists” merely for having strong views and opinions regarding a number of topics.

For instance, if you are concerned about illegal immigration or oppose abortion, you may be labeled as a threat. The federal government has expanded its definitions of “extremism” and “potential terrorism” to include a wide range of people and their views — chances are that anyone reading this falls into at least one of these categories.

Michael Snyder of TheTruthWins.com has compiled a list of 72 types of people [1] classified in U.S. government documents as extremists or potential terrorists.

The documents include military training manuals [2] and memos [3]; terrorism training manuals for law enforcement [4]; guidelines from the National Consortium for the Study of Terrorism and Responses to Terrorism (START) [5] and other sources.
